INHALANTS (LISTEN MAGAZINE)
Once upon a time there was a big bad wolf who huffed and puffed. Remember the fairy tale about the three little pigs and the huffing wolf? Well, the kind of “huffing” people do today doesn’t have a fairy-tale ending. Huffing, bagging and sniffing are ways kids inhale the fumes of common household poisons to get a quick high. For teens, inhaling poisonous household substances is third in popularity behind alcohol and tobacco. You might ask “how dangerous can inhaling furniture polish or cooking spray possibly be? HYPERTENSION VIBRANT LIFE MAGAZINE
Hypertension, or high blood pressure is the most prevalent circulatory problem in the United States. Nearly 50 million adutls--28 percent of the population--have high blood pressure or are using lifestyle measures or medication to control their blood pressure. And your chances of becoming hypertensive increase as you age. A recent study by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ention showed that hypertension is present in more than 50 percent of Americans over age 60. AIDS THE PROBLEM THE SOLUTION (LISTEN MAGAZINE)
AIDS now ranks among the top three killers of young adults, a new report says. And the most recent rankings by gender place it as the second leading cause of death for men and sixth for women ages 25 to 44, says the federal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, Atlanta. “Three-fourths of the deaths from AIDS occur in this age group, says Dr. Peter Drotman of CDC. It’s affecting the age group that is usually the most productive.” Among the men, only accidents claimed more lives. STRESS SPECIAL (VIBRANT MAGAZINE)
Just how serious is stress? An estiamted 75 percent of all visits to primary-care physicians are for stress-related disorders. Accoding to the American Institute of Stress, every week 112 million people take medication for stress-related symptoms, and job stress alone costs American industry more than $150 billion a year in absenteeism, lost productivity, accidents and medical insurance.
